Preparation

Preparation

1. Prepare the Ingredients

Chop the onions, carrots, and celery into small pieces. Mince the garlic cloves and set aside.

2. Brown the Meats

In a large pot, heat a little oil over medium-high heat. Add the oxtail and pork ribs, browning them on all sides. Remove from pot and set aside.

Cooking

3. Sauté the Vegetables

In the same pot, add the chopped onions, carrots, celery, and minced garlic. Sauté for about 5-7 minutes until softened.

4. Deglaze with Wine

Pour in the red wine, scraping the bottom of the pot to release any browned bits. Let it simmer for about 5 minutes.

5. Add Meats and Broth

Return the browned oxtail and pork ribs to the pot. Add the tomato puree and beef broth. Stir to combine.

6. Season the Stew

Add bay leaves, salt, and black pepper to taste. Bring to a gentle boil.

7. Simmer

Reduce heat to low, cover the pot, and let simmer for about 2.5 to 3 hours, or until the meat is tender and falling off the bone.

Finishing Touches

8. Serve

Once the stew is ready, remove bay leaves. Adjust seasoning if needed. Serve hot, garnished with freshly chopped parsley.
